This compact, easy-access guide to behavioral problems encountered in veterinary practice offers immediate and helpful advice for today's veterinary team. Instructor resources are available; please contact your Elsevier sales representative for details.

  • Coverage offers immediate advice to the veterinary team who are often presented with behavioral problems in their practice.
  • Easy-to-read format includes introductions, medical differentials, underlying causes, diagnosis, action boxes, and summaries.
  • Content refers the reader to other chapters throughout the book, so that information can be found quickly and easily.
  • Helpful handouts, which can be photocopied, offer yet another way to further your learning experience.

BEHAVIOUR PROBLEMS IN SMALL ANIMALS: PRACTCAL ADVICE FOR THE VETERINARY TEAM

JAN BOWEN AND SARAH HEATH

Reviewed by Francesca Riccomini for the Veterinary Times

A book that not only raises and addresses the issues that are important when dealing with companion animal behaviour and problems relating to it in practice, but also explains in detailed, straightforward terms how to manage them, both long and short-term, has long been needed, making this text most welcome.

The contents overview at the beginning, provision of a short list of first-aid measures, and the use of boxes and summary tables emphasising essential points of each condition is of particular value for anyone faced with a behavioural crisis that requires immediate advice to prevent further deterioration of a potentially serious situation, significant erosion of a pet's welfare, or the precipitate rupture of the owner-pet bond.

This format also serves as a useful aide memoire for those involved in behaviour counselling or colleagues seeking reassurance when organising an referral.

The degree of detail included in the handouts is an especially attractive feature of this text. This book seems to represent good value for money and should prove a most useful addition to the library of any clinic or individual with a behavioural bent.
